Basement drainage installation services involve setting up systems designed to manage excess water around a property's foundation. These services typically include installing drain tiles, sump pumps, and other components that direct water away from the basement area. Proper installation helps prevent water from seeping through basement walls or floors, reducing the risk of water damage and structural issues. The process often involves assessing the property's drainage needs, excavating around the foundation, and integrating drainage solutions that work effectively with existing landscaping and drainage patterns.
This service is essential for addressing common problems associated with basement moisture and flooding. Excess water can lead to mold growth, musty odors, and damage to stored belongings or finished basement spaces. In regions prone to heavy rainfall or with high water tables, inadequate drainage can result in persistent dampness or even flooding. Basement drainage installation helps mitigate these issues by providing a reliable pathway for water to escape, thereby maintaining a dry and stable basement environment.

The overview below groups typical Basement Drainage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Antioch,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Basement drainage installation costs typically vary from $1,500 to $4,500 depending on the size and complexity of the project, with some jobs in Antioch, TN, costing around $2,500. Factors influencing costs include the type of drainage system and site conditions.
Material Expenses - The price for drainage materials such as sump pumps, piping, and gravel can range from $300 to $1,200, with higher-end systems costing more for enhanced durability and performance.
Labor Costs - Labor expenses for installing basement drainage systems gener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the project's scope and local contractor rates in Antioch, TN.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, excavation, and repair work, which can add $500 to $1,500 to the overall project budget, varying based on site-specific requ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is basement drainage installation? Basement drainage installation involves setting up systems to manage water around a basement to prevent flooding and water damage.
Why is proper drainage important for basements? Proper drainage helps prevent water accumulation, which can lead to structural issues, mold growth, and interior water damage.
What types of drainage systems are available? Common options include interior drain tiles, exterior waterproofing membranes, and sump pump systems, depending on the property's needs.
How do local contractors determine the best drainage solution? Contractors assess the basement's condition, surrounding soil, and water flow patterns to recommend suitable drainage options.
